California’s Emergency Communication Challenges

California faces some of the most complex emergency risks in the country, including:

  • Earthquakes that can instantly disable infrastructure
  • Wildfires causing widespread evacuations and power shutoffs
  • Public Safety Power Shutoffs (PSPS) during high fire danger
  • Flooding and mudslides following heavy rain and burn scars
  • Extreme heat stressing the electrical grid
  • Severe storms and coastal hazards

During these events, commercial communication systems often fail or become overwhelmed. A ham radio go box allows operators to communicate using VHF, UHF, and HF amateur radio, even when traditional networks are unavailable.

Power Outages, PSPS, and Grid Reliability

Power outages in California are caused by wildfires, extreme heat, storms, and intentional Public Safety Power Shutoffs. Many ham radio go boxes are designed with:

  • Internal battery power
  • Solar charging capability
  • Efficient DC power distribution

These features allow communication for hours or days without grid power, ensuring operators remain connected during extended outages.
